Monsters Under the Pillow and Spirals of Thought: Lisa SQ’s New Single ‘Cold Little Fingers’


In her new single “Cold Little Fingers,” Hamilton-based indie-rock artist Lisa SQ invites listeners into the space between sleep and wakefulness – a place where nightmares whisper, hearts beat in rhythm with anxiety, and childhood fears come alive in the dark.

“Cold Little Fingers” is the tremble under your fingertips, the restless tossing in bed, the dizzying whispers, befriending the monsters beneath the pillow, and the spiral of thoughts winding through the night. It’s an attempt to hold onto composure at the edge of madness, a plunge into a chaotic world where every emotion is felt on the skin. Recorded live at Dwaynespace in Toronto with a close-knit team of friends, the track captures the magic of nocturnal chaos — alive, imperfect, and mesmerizing. “Cold Little Fingers” offers an early glimpse into Lisa SQ’s artistry: turbulent, sincere, and joyfully chaotic.
